LT - 12/07 Taught to Prosper Thus saith the Lord , thy Redeemer, the Holy One of Israel; I am the Lord thy God which teacheth thee to profit, which leadeth thee by the way that thou shouldest go. Isaiah 48:17 What a man is not taught, he cannot touch successfully no matter how he struggles.What a man did not learn well, he can never earn well from it; all he will be getting are mercy drops, never a shower of blessing. What a man never stooped down to get, he will never be able to stand up to succeed in it and sustain it! God does not give wealth, He empowers man to be wealthy. He doesnt give prosperity either, He rather teaches man to prosper and leads in the way man should go. When the One known as Rabbi or Teacher came in the flesh, the first lecture He gave was.... Repent: for the kingdom of heaven is at hand.(Matthew 4:17). Repent is not just confessing of sin, it is also having a change of mind, a change of thinking. A change of mind because another kingdom or government had come! A government that is ruled from the invisible, a kingdom you cannot be part of except you are delivered from the old one; the kingdom of the world ruled by Satan (Colossians 1:13). For those who believed Him, He taught them how to prosper in business, career, profession, trade or venture of any kind because He came to do the business of the Father too (Luke. 2:49). These are some of His teachings: => He taught Peter how to trade at periods when all his competitors have called it quits...Luke.5:4 => He taught Peter how to connect with those that carry what he needed.....Matthew. 17:27 => He taught Peter how to step into areas where others will naturally sink...Matthew. 14:29 => He taught the disciples how to use what they have to get what they needed...Luke. 9:16 => He taught the disciples how to be organised to meet their customers need...Luke. 9:14,15 => He taught the disciples how to locate the place where to pursue their purpose...Luke. 22:10 => He taught the disciples how to get what they wanted by saying what they are told by the Lord..Mark.11:1-6 When He was going, He didnt leave us without a professor; He gave us the Holy Spirit as our new Teacher (John.14:26).That was the Teacher that taught the widow of Zarepath to share her last meal, the widow of the son of prophet to borrow vessels and use what she had to get what she wanted and the Shunamite woman to give lunch to the prophet and gave him accommodation to become a mother after she has passed bearing the fruit of the womb! But the question is who will He teach?...Whom shall he teach knowledge? and whom shall he make to understand doctrine? them that are weaned from the milk, and drawn from the breasts.(Isaiah 28:9). He will teach only those who are childlike in His hands, instruct only those who are hungry and thirsty for His Word and most importantly, He is constantly ready to guide the meek and the humble in heart. Are you ready and willing to be taught by the Spirit? This is your week.
